A city being redesigned and rebuilt.
A city being redesigned and rebuilt. Somewhat ‘empty’ but not deserted. A fresh and positive feel. The adorable Avon River runs through town…… worth exploring all the way to the coast on cycles. Heaps of parks, many with features suitable for kids. Earthquake Museum was fascinating……. my 14 & 12 year old boys were mesmerised. No earthquakes back in Sydney. Good food all over the city. We caught public buses(route 29) from airport and return. Recommended!! Great city!Guest review byAnthonyAustralia - 8.0

Larnach Castle stay was a highlight and also visiting the...
Larnach Castle stay was a highlight and also visiting the Orokonui Sanctuary. Photo of sunrise from room 22 at the lodge at the castle. Dunedin has lovely cafes but Coffee Culture Roslyn stood out as a great find. Beautiful freshly made keto bacon and egg flan. Photo of old fire door table. Lots of old buildings and great museums including a live butterfly collection. Don’t forget to get your fuel before heading out of town.Guest review byCindyAustralia - 10.0
We ended up staying at the Tasman holiday park, the bed was...
We ended up staying at the Tasman holiday park, the bed was so much more comfortable and the manager there was so lovely. Te Anau was a great spot to see the glow worm caves, which was our highlight and we drove to do the Milford sound and it was a beautiful drive, which took about 2 hours both ways. There’s some lovely cafes and restaurants, gift shops and supermarkets. The bird sanctuary to se the Takahe was also a great stop.Guest review byJacqui - 10.0
